Mud walls in the Caribbean: Coro built with earth as no other city in the region did, fusing local techniques with Spanish Mudéjar style and Dutch influences from the nearby Antilles. Founded in 1527 among the earliest colonial towns of the Americas, it retains some 602 historic buildings. UNESCO inscribed Coro and its port of La Vela in 1993.
